Summary
Reaffirms the right of access of landlocked countries to and from the sea and freedom of transit through the territory of transit countries by all means of transport, as set forth in article 125 of the UN Convention on the Law of the Sea; emphasizes that assistance for the improvement of transit transport facilities and services should be integrated into the overall economic development strategies of the landlocked and transit developing countries and that donor countries should consequently take into account the requirements for the long-term restructuring of the economies of the landlocked developing countries; requests the Secretary-General to convene in 2003 an International Ministerial Meeting of Landlocked and Transit Developing Countries and Donor Countries and International Financial and Development Institutions on Transit Transport Cooperation, within the existing resources of the budget for the biennium 2002-2003 and with voluntary contributions, to review the current situation of transit transport systems, including the implementation of the Global Framework for Transit Transport Cooperation of 1995; decides to consider the precise timing and venue of the International Ministerial Meeting at its 57th session, taking into consideration the generous offer made by the Government of Kazakhstan to host the meeting; requests the Secretary-General to prepare a report on the implementation of the present resolution and to submit it to the Trade and Development Board and to the General Assembly at its 57th session.
